I received a letter about repairs to the sidewalk. Who will be doing the sidewalk repairs?
The property owner has a choice to contract privately for the necessary repair work or have the City’s contractor complete the work. The City competitively bids or quotes the sidewalk improvement project each year. The City awards the project to the lowest responsible, licensed and bonded, bidder and City staff will perform the construction administration. If you choose to contract the necessary repair work privately, the contractor must be licensed and bonded by the City and written notice provided to the City Engineer’s office along with a completed permit application to complete the work.
